The world of insects is fascinating, and one of the most intriguing creatures is the praying mantis. This insect is known for its unique hunting style, where it waits patiently for its prey and then strikes with lightning speed. One of the most interesting aspects of the praying mantis is its unique mating behavior, where the female praying mantis is known to bite the head off the male after mating. This behavior is a fascinating example of the complex social dynamics of insects and offers insights into the evolutionary advantages of such behavior. There are many variations of the praying mantis, each with its unique characteristics and behaviors. For example, the Chinese mantis is known for its distinctive green color, while the Carolina mantis is recognized by its brown or gray coloration. For those interested in getting started with observing or studying the praying mantis, there are several practical tips to keep in mind. First, it's essential to create a suitable habitat that mimics the natural environment of the praying mantis. This can include providing a terrarium or a bug catcher with the right temperature, humidity, and lighting conditions. Additionally, patience is key when observing the praying mantis, as it can take time to spot and study these elusive creatures.

Another important aspect to consider is the importance of conservation when it comes to the praying mantis. As with many insect species, the praying mantis is facing threats such as habitat destruction and climate change. By supporting conservation efforts and protecting natural habitats, we can help ensure the long-term survival of this fascinating species.
